Icelandic Monument: Viking Ship and Lighthouse, Spanish Fork, Utah

What s an odd little lighthouse, topped with Viking Dragon Boat weathervane, doing in landlocked Spanish Fork, Utah? It was built in 1938-39 to honor the first permanent Icelandic settlement in the USA. The original 16 settlers weren t lured to Spanish Fork s by its un-Icelandic climate. They were religious zealots, Mormon converts who, according to the church, were banished for their beliefs and decided that Utah was the place to resettle. Spanish Fork holds an Icelandic Days festival every summer in their honor. According to a plaque bolted to the lighthouse, the Viking boat is a tribute to Leif Eiriksson, an Icelander, who discovered America in 1000 A.D.
